Types of E-Bike Batteries
There are several types of e-bike batteries available in the market, but the most common ones are:
- Lithium-ion (Li-ion) batteries: These are the most popular type of e-bike battery due to their high energy density, lightweight, and long lifespan. They are also more expensive than other types of batteries.
- Nickel-metal hydride (NiMH) batteries: These batteries are less common than Li-ion batteries but are still used in some e-bikes. They are heavier and have a shorter lifespan than Li-ion batteries.
- Lead-acid batteries: These batteries are the least expensive but also the heaviest and have the shortest lifespan. They are not commonly used in e-bikes anymore.
Battery Capacity
The capacity of an e-bike battery is measured in watt-hours (Wh). The higher the watt-hours, the longer the battery can provide power to the motor. However, higher capacity batteries are also heavier and more expensive.
Battery Management System (BMS)
The Battery Management System (BMS) is a critical component of an e-bike battery. It monitors the battery’s voltage, temperature, and current, and protects the battery from overcharging, over-discharging, and overheating.
Battery Maintenance
Proper battery maintenance is essential to extend the lifespan of an e-bike battery. Some tips for maintaining the battery include:
- Charge the battery after each use
- Store the battery in a cool, dry place
- Avoid deep discharging the battery
- Use the correct charger for the battery
